SINGAPORE, June 8, 2016 /PRNewswire/ -- Active Ager Asia, an online wellness portal, has launched in Singapore. The portal pays members to walk, in an effort to encourage Singaporeans to start and maintain a healthy lifestyle.
To get rewarded, members have to take part in Challenges by walking a specified number of steps over a fixed time period. Time periods vary from a day, to a week and to a month. Rewards range from cash to small items such as supermarket vouchers and to large value experiences such as staycations.
"Many people are apathetic towards keeping healthy habits, especially when they are feeling well. We are approaching health maintenance by working with the most common unit of activity, walking," Aaron Kong, Managing Director, Active Ager Asia said. "This is the first wellness programme in Singapore that pays members to walk. We want to be the external motivational trigger, the carrot, that gets members walking and started on a healthy lifestyle."

About Active Ager Asia
Active Ager Asia is an online wellness portal that rewards members for walking. We are device and mobile operating system-neutral and integrate with Fitbit, Google Fit, Jawbone and MOVES to track steps, distance and calories. Registration is free and members can upgrade with an annual fee to access Challenges and events to earn rewards and incentives.
We believe walking is the simplest type of exercise that can contribute to big gains in physical fitness and health maintenance. We incentivise members by paying them to walk and reap the benefits of regular and active exercise thereafter. Our portal can be found at www.activeager.asia.
